Waiting for the findings of forensic medicine in the Altenrhein SG case

On Wednesday, two dead people were discovered in a detached house in Altenrhein SG. It is still unclear how and under what circumstances the 41-year-old woman and the 48-year-old man died. According to the cantonal police, it will only be possible to find out once forensic investigations have been carried out.

The two people were found lifeless at midday on Wednesday. The cantonal police issued a statement in the early evening saying that they were assuming a violent crime, but that investigations into the cause of death and possible sequence of events had only just begun.

The police were also unable to completely rule out the involvement of third parties. At the moment, however, they do not believe that there is any danger to the public, they said.

Even a day later, there were still no new findings, police spokesman Florian Schneider told the Keystone-SDA news agency on Thursday. First of all, the forensic medical examination had to be awaited. This could take a few days.
